The Scientific research of Sleep


Rest is a complicated organic procedure that allows the body to recoup and regrow. During rest, the mind cycles through various phases, including REM (rapid eye movement) and non-REM sleep. Each stage serves particular features, such as memory loan consolidation, emotional processing, and physical repair service.


Hormones play a vital duty in managing rest. For instance, melatonin aids signify the body to plan for rest, while cortisol degrees vary throughout the day to promote performance. Disturbances to this balance can result in sleep wake problems, which can harm general health.


Furthermore, persistent sleep issues can exacerbate existing health conditions, consisting of cardiovascular problems and diabetes. Recognizing these biological processes highlights why keeping top notch sleep is essential for lasting health and wellness.

Sorts Of Rest Disorders


Sleep disorders encompass a range of problems that can significantly affect an individual's lifestyle. Recognizing the particular type of disorder is vital for reliable therapy and administration.


Sleeplessness and Related Issues


Insomnia is identified by trouble falling or staying asleep. It can be intense or persistent, with causes varying from stress and stress and anxiety to medical conditions. Individuals may experience daytime exhaustion, impatience, and trouble concentrating.


Relevant concerns consist of rest beginning sleeplessness, where people battle to sleep, and upkeep insomnia, which involves waking regularly during the evening. Therapy options can include cognitive behavior modification and drugs like benzodiazepines or non-benzodiazepine rest help. Way of life changes, such as establishing a regular rest routine, can also profit those dealing with insomnia.


Sleep-Related Breathing Conditions


Sleep-related breathing problems, such as obstructive sleep apnea (OSA), entail interruptions in breathing throughout sleep. OSA happens when throat muscular tissues kick back exceedingly, blocking the air passage. This problem can cause disrupted rest and lower oxygen degrees, influencing overall wellness.


Signs and symptoms might include loud snoring, wheezing for air throughout rest, and extreme daytime drowsiness. Medical diagnosis normally includes a rest study. Treatment usually consists of way of life modifications, such as weight loss, and the use of continual positive respiratory tract stress (CPAP) devices. In many cases, surgical procedure may be required to eliminate cells obstructing the airway.


Body Clock Sleep-Wake Disorders


Body clock sleep-wake disorders take place when a person's inner biological rhythm is misaligned with their outside setting. Usual types consist of delayed rest phase problem and shift work problem. The former leads to late rest start and wake times, while the last affects those working non-traditional hours.


Symptoms usually consist of insomnia and excessive daytime drowsiness. Handling these conditions may involve light therapy, melatonin supplements, or changing rest schedules. Maintaining a constant rest routine can considerably assist in straightening one's body clock.


Parasomnias and Treatment Options


Parasomnias are disruptive sleep problems that entail uncommon actions throughout rest. Usual kinds consist of sleepwalking, rest chatting, and night horrors. These episodes can lead to injuries and significant distress for the influenced person and their household.


Therapy for parasomnias usually concentrates on ensuring risk-free rest settings and taking care of anxiety. Behavioral therapy can be efficient, along with medications sometimes to minimize episodes. Understanding triggers and preserving a regular sleep routine can likewise reduce events of parasomnia, boosting the overall rest experience.



Identifying Rest Disorders


Identifying rest disorders includes an organized technique that normally starts with a detailed consultation and might include different specialized examinations. Acknowledging the symptoms and obtaining the best info is necessary for effective treatment.


Appointment with a Rest Expert


Throughout the very first meeting with a rest professional, the individual gives a comprehensive medical history. This consists of rest patterns, way of life routines, and any kind of existing clinical problems.


The doctor may ask concerns such as:



  • The amount of hours of sleep do you obtain each evening?

  • Do you experience daytime tiredness?

  • Exist any considerable way of life changes recently?


Based on the info gathered, the professional might take into consideration differential medical diagnoses. A physical examination might follow, focusing on signs of rest conditions, such as weight problems or irregular breathing patterns during sleep.


Sleep Studies and Tests


If required, the sleep professional might advise additional examination through sleep researches, generally known as polysomnography. This examination records mind activity, oxygen degrees, heart price, and breathing during rest.


An additional alternative is home rest apnea screening, which permits individuals to monitor their sleep in a comfortable atmosphere. This includes utilizing mobile devices to track snoring, air movement, and blood oxygen degrees.


Sometimes, extra laboratory examinations might be bought to check for related problems, such as thyroid issues. These evaluations assist in pinpointing the source of sleep disturbances and overview treatment plans successfully.

Creating an Ideal Rest Setting


A favorable rest setting promotes relaxation and improves rest top quality. Keep the bedroom cool, ideally in between 60-67 ° F(15-20 ° C), to promote a comfortable sleeping temperature.


Darkness is vital; take into consideration using blackout curtains or an eye mask to block out light, which can help indicate the body that it is time to sleep.


Lessening sound is an additional vital factor. Use earplugs or a white noise device if required. The bed mattress and pillows must supply ample assistance and convenience, aiding to stay clear of discomfort that can interfere with rest.


Healthy Sleep Habits and Routines


Developing consistent rest behaviors help in managing rest cycles. Going to bed and waking up at the same time each day, even on weekends, aids keep a consistent biological rhythm.


Taking part in kicking back activities prior to going to bed, such as reading or exercising deep-breathing workouts, can signal to the body that it's time to wind down. Restricting screen time from devices at the very least an hour before sleep also lowers direct exposure to blue light, which can disrupt sleep.


In addition, avoiding high levels of caffeine and heavy meals close to going to bed supports far better sleep. Regular exercise during the day can additionally promote much deeper sleep, as long as it's not too near to bedtime.
